Happening this Month
Online Panel:
What Writers Must Know About Finding & Working with Representation Today
Wednesday, September 30, 2020
6:00 – 8:00 p.m. Pacific Time. (This is to accommodate other time zones)
IWOSC members – free
Non-members – $15
Jump down to register
Online via GoToWebinar
If you choose the route of traditional publishing, it’s more important than ever to have trustworthy, reliable, and knowledgeable representation to guide your book or screenplay (and you!).
We will be having a candid and thorough discussion of the factors (subtle and otherwise) that go into whether a book/screenplay (or an author) gets past the gatekeepers or not. For instance, how important are one’s social media footprint, level of fame, and prestige college or educational credentials in determining a “yes” or a “no” — regardless of the quality of a book or movie? How does someone’s race, gender or sexual preference, or social/economic class affect their chances of getting a good book or TV/movie deal?
